Job Description

Overview Join our dynamic team as an Event Planner and bring unforgettable experiences to life! In this energetic role, you will coordinate and execute a wide range of events, from corporate gatherings and weddings to community festivals and fundraising galas. Your passion for hospitality, meticulous organization, and creative flair will ensure every detail is flawlessly managed. This paid position offers a fantastic opportunity to develop your skills in event marketing, customer service, and vendor negotiations while delivering exceptional guest experiences. If you thrive in fast-paced environments and love turning ideas into memorable realities, this is the perfect role for you! Duties Collaborate with clients to understand their vision, goals, and budget for each event Develop comprehensive event plans, timelines, and checklists to ensure seamless execution Negotiate contracts with vendors including caterers, decorators, entertainment providers, and venue staff Coordinate logistics such as catering arrangements, banquet setups, guest accommodations, and transportation Manage event marketing efforts to promote events through social media, email campaigns, and local outreach Oversee onsite event setup, management, and breakdown to guarantee smooth operations Provide exceptional customer service by addressing guest inquiries and resolving issues promptly during events Monitor budgets closely, track expenses, and identify opportunities for upselling additional services or upgrades Maintain strong communication with all stakeholders—clients, vendors, venue staff—to ensure alignment and clarity Conduct post-event evaluations to gather feedback and identify areas for improvement Qualifications Proven experience in event planning or hospitality roles such as restaurant management, hotel services, or banquet coordination Strong negotiation skills with the ability to secure favorable contracts and vendor agreements Excellent marketing knowledge to effectively promote events and increase attendance Skilled in upselling additional services like catering upgrades or premium packages Familiarity with event marketing strategies and customer engagement techniques Exceptional organizational skills with the 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ously under tight deadlines Experience in budgeting and financial management for events of varying sizes Outstanding communication skills to liaise confidently with clients, vendors, and team members Background in banquet operations or catering services is highly desirable Knowledge of contracts, guest services, hospitality standards, and fundraising activities enhances your candidacy Embark on a rewarding journey where your creativity meets meticulous planning!
